Christian wrote:

> the vertsplit feature has been removed as of 7.4.1611 and is since then 
> controlled by the +windows feature. However the documentation still 
> talks about it as of being enabled for normal builds.
> 
> So I suggest the following change:
> 
> idiff --git a/runtime/doc/various.txt b/runtime/doc/various.txt
> index 24290faf9..dd097fbc9 100644
> --- a/runtime/doc/various.txt
> +++ b/runtime/doc/various.txt
> @@ -438,7 +438,8 @@ N  *+title*         Setting the window 'title' and 'icon'
>  N  *+toolbar*          |gui-toolbar|
>  N  *+user_commands*    User-defined commands. |user-commands|
>  N  *+viminfo*          |'viminfo'|
> -N  *+vertsplit*                Vertically split windows |:vsplit|
> +S  *+vertsplit*                Vertically split windows |:vsplit| Since 
> 7.4.1611
> +                       the same as the |+windows| feature
>  N  *+virtualedit*      |'virtualedit'|
>  S  *+visual*           Visual mode |Visual-mode| Always enabled since 
> 7.4.200.
>  N  *+visualextra*      extra Visual mode commands |blockwise-operators|

Thanks.  Using "in sync with" is a bit better than "the same as", since
it's still a separate feature to check for.
